Posted - 10/10/2010 : 03:28:29 Don't worry... it takes one extra day for new players to appear (for whatever reason, the traded player is whited out the next day, but the new player takes 2 days to appear). Make sure, too, in your pool settings that you have allowed enough players to show the trade (for example, in our pool, there are 23 players per team, but in the pool settings I have an allowance for 30 players). Also, if you look at the total points for the night, you'll probably see that the new player, even though they don't appear right away, has been accumulating points (check totals). Hope that help! |
